Editor's takeAirwallex lets businesses hold and manage more than 20 currencies with local bank details in over 60 countries, avoiding forced conversions. The base account plan can run free of charge if a business deposits $5,000 monthly or keeps a $10,000 balance. Funds are not covered by the UK's FSCS because Airwallex operates as an Electronic Money Institution rather than a bank.

Is Airwallex a licensed bank?

No. Airwallex operates as an Electronic Money Institution, so customer funds are not protected by the UK's Financial Services Compensation Scheme, according to a review by Noda.

How much does an Airwallex account cost?

The base plan can be free of monthly fees if a business deposits $5,000 per month or maintains a $10,000 balance, according to XFlowPay's review of the pricing.

Editor's takeTipalti works as a global remittance engine, not just an AP tool, for companies paying suppliers across many countries. The KPMG-approved tax engine automates W-9 and W-8 collection, a real time-saver for US companies with international vendors. Buyers should plan for a multi-month implementation and account pre-funding that ties up cash.

How many countries can Tipalti pay suppliers in?

It supports payments to 196 countries in 120 currencies, using more than 50 payment methods.

Does Tipalti require pre-funded accounts?

Yes. Tipalti typically requires pre-funding a virtual account before it can execute payments, unlike some AP tools that draw directly from a bank account.

Editor's takeGravity Software fills the gap between QuickBooks and enterprise ERPs like NetSuite, built directly on Microsoft's Power Platform so it inherits Office 365, Power BI, and Azure security by default. Publishing exact pricing, $375 a month for the first user plus $0.29 per AP transaction, is genuinely rare in this category and undercuts NetSuite's roughly $1,000-a-month entry point. The tradeoffs are real too: no built-in payroll, and some users describe the interface as clunky next to lighter modern SaaS tools.

How much does Gravity Software cost?

Pricing starts at $375 a month for the first user, with AP automation billed at $0.29 per transaction, both listed publicly.

Does Gravity Software include payroll?

No. It lacks a built-in payroll module, so businesses needing payroll will need a separate tool alongside Gravity.

Editor's takeRillion's pricing model stands out in AP automation: no per-user license fees, ever, with cost instead tied to invoice volume. That structure favors growing mid-market companies over the seat-based pricing common in this category. Formed from the merger of Palette Software and Centsoft, the company brings 30 years of combined experience and now serves over 3,000 clients and 250,000 users. Its 50-plus ERP integrations, including deep support for Microsoft Dynamics and NetSuite, cover most mid-market finance stacks, though G2 reviewers consistently flag the search function as a weak point.

Does Rillion charge per user?

No. Rillion includes unlimited users and entities with no per-user license fees. Pricing is instead based on invoice volume, which the vendor says keeps costs low for growing teams.

Which ERP systems does Rillion integrate with?

Rillion connects to more than 50 ERP systems, with deep support for Microsoft Dynamics 365, BC and AX, NetSuite, Sage Intacct and X3, and SAP Business One.

Editor's takeQuadient AP skips per-seat licensing entirely, a real differentiator in a market where most AP tools charge per user. Its AI SmartCoding claims 99 percent accuracy on invoice header data, and the four-module suite covers invoices, purchase orders, payments, and expenses in one system built for organizations managing multiple legal entities. Security runs deep with SOC 1 & 2, HIPAA, and ISO 27001 certification, backed by a public parent company processing over $31 billion in AP spend, though users consistently report slow support response times and occasional QuickBooks Desktop sync errors.

Does Quadient AP charge per user?

No. All plans include unlimited users, avoiding per-seat licensing fees entirely, according to Quadient's own pricing page.

Are there known integration issues with Quadient AP?

Yes, with specific platforms. Documented sync errors exist for QuickBooks Desktop and Sage integrations, according to Quadient's own help center articles.

Editor's takeSoftLedger consolidates multiple entities in real time, automating inter-company eliminations that many systems still handle in batch at month-end. It stands out as the first general ledger with a native crypto module, tracking cost basis and gain/loss for assets like Bitcoin and Ethereum directly in the books. Pricing starts at $750 a month but includes unlimited entities, a rare structure for holding companies that would otherwise pay per-entity fees elsewhere, though users report limited reporting customization and occasional bank feed errors.

Does SoftLedger charge per entity?

No. Plans starting at $750 a month include unlimited entities, unusual for multi-entity accounting software that typically charges per subsidiary.

Can SoftLedger track cryptocurrency transactions?

Yes. It includes a native module for assets like Bitcoin, Ethereum, Solana, and Cardano, automating cost basis and gain/loss tracking.

Editor's takeFidesic is the only invoice processing tool built to integrate with Binary Stream's Multi-Entity Management for Dynamics 365 Business Central, using native AL and Dexterity code instead of generic connectors. A hybrid AI-human OCR process claims 96% accuracy on invoice data. The tradeoff is narrow scope, since it only serves Microsoft Dynamics GP and Business Central users.

Does Fidesic work outside the Microsoft Dynamics ecosystem?

No. Fidesic is built specifically for Dynamics GP and Business Central, using native AL and Dexterity integration code. Organizations on NetSuite, SAP, or other ERPs should look elsewhere.

Is there a free version of Fidesic?

Yes. The Fidesic for Free plan includes 1 company, 3 users, and 100 invoices per month at no cost. Pro plans add per-user pricing starting at $9 for approver seats.

Editor's takeSage AP Automation's core claim checks out on cost. Automating the workflow drops per-invoice processing from roughly $16 to under $3, and AI capture eliminates up to 83 percent of manual data entry. The native tie to Sage 50, 100, 300, and Intacct is the whole point. That same integration is also the weak spot, with users documenting sync errors like invalid password failures that need manual troubleshooting in SmartSync Manager.

Does Sage AP Automation reduce invoice processing costs?

Yes, according to vendor data. Automating the workflow can cut the cost of processing one invoice from about $16 to under $3, and AI capture reduces manual data entry by up to 83 percent.

Are there known issues syncing with Sage ERPs?

Yes. Users have reported sync errors, including an invalid password error, when connecting to Sage 100 and 300, which requires troubleshooting in the SmartSync Manager tool.
